Edge Computing Streaming
Edge computing streaming is a technology approach that processes and analyzes data streams in real-time at the edge of the network, close to where data is generated, rather than sending all data to a centralized cloud. It combines edge computing principles with streaming data processing to enable low-latency, bandwidth-efficient applications like video analytics, IoT monitoring, and real-time decision-making. This reduces reliance on cloud infrastructure for time-sensitive operations while maintaining scalability.
Developers should learn edge computing streaming for applications requiring ultra-low latency (e.g., autonomous vehicles, industrial automation) or operating in bandwidth-constrained environments (e.g., remote sensors, mobile networks). It's essential for real-time analytics in IoT, video surveillance, and AR/VR systems where immediate data processing at the source improves performance and reduces costs compared to cloud-only solutions.
